Zamfara Police Rescue A Year Old Baby,6 Others From Bandits

The Rescued women

Zamfara state Police Command says its operatives have bursted bandits and terrorists along Zurmi – Jibia road and rescue a one-year old baby and 6 women.

This was contained in a press release signed and made available to Radio Nigeria in Gusau by the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O) SP Mohammed Shehu.

SP Shehu explained that, today (Friday) police operatives received an intelligence information about the abduction of the victims on Thursday at Kadamutsa village of Zurmi local government area of Zamfara State, hence the Police Tactical Operatives in collaboration with Vigilante acted professionally and gallantly leading to the rescue of all the victims unconditionally.

The PPRO noted that the Police operatives mobilized to the location where a search and rescue operation was conducted along Zurmi – Jibiya axis, leading to the rescue of all the 6 women and one old child unhurt.

Mr Shehu said the victims were medically checked, debriefed by the Police detectives and handed them over to their families.

The Commissioner of Police, CP Kolo Yusuf, while commending the Police operatives and vigilante for the successful rescue operation, congratulated the victims for regaining their freedom, and reiterated the Command’s continuous determination to rid the state of criminal activities and apprehend criminal elements committing heinous crimes across the state.
